Two men fighting for life after double shooting on Robinson Street in Richmond Fan neighborhood
![](https://cedarnews.net/wp-content/uploads/2023/11/68A2A194-03FB-4142-A8D7-6FDC3B62CC33.jpeg)
RICHMOND, Va. — Two men were left fighting for life after being shot in Richmond’s Fan neighborhood over the weekend.
A spokesperson with the Richmond Police Department said officers were called to the corner of South Robinson Street near the intersection of West Main Street around 2 a.m. Sunday, Nov. 12 for the report of a shooting.
Upon arrival, officers found several parked cars in the area had been hit by gunfire.
“A short time later, two vehicles arrived at a local hospital each transporting an adult male suffering from a gunshot wound,” Richmond Police said.
The two men were treated for injuries considered to be life-threatening, according to police, who determined both men had been injured in the South Robinson Street shooting.
